We had their unli with beef, and overall it was positive experience. I don't think their meat is actually anything special, I don't really feel like I had anything that stood out meat-wise. However, their sides were nice, and the fact that everything, including the steamed egg and tofu stew was refillable is a plus. Their japchae was nice, their tofu stew was nice, and their steamed egg was nice. Service was pretty good, I never really had to chase after any waiter because they regularly came to our table to either change the grill or top it up with water, or refill anything we needed. It's also good that they have a valet here, as parking in remedios circle can be challenging but that makes it easier.
